RELATED STUDIES

Every two weeks, we read and discuss a paper that is related to our project in one way or another. These papers give us a better understanding of the field of synthetic biology and let us know what has been done so far. We hope that these papers and presentations will serve you as well as they have served us.

An enzyme-coupled biosensor enables (S)-reticuline production in yeast from glucose
Presentation: File:Team Dalhousie Reticuline Production.ppt

Engineering microbial cell factories for biosynthesis of isoprenoid molecules: beyond lycopene
